Where to stay in Hadspen

Launceston CBD
Launceston CBD is known for its enchanting waterfalls, and you can make a stop by Boags Brewery and Princess Theatre while in the area.

Riverside
Restaurants, shopping, and river views are some highlights of Riverside. Make a stop by Tamar Island Wetlands Centre or Tasmania Zoo while you're exploring.

Invermay
Travelers like the museums in Invermay, and University of Tasmania Stadium is a top attraction you might want to visit.

West Launceston
You'll enjoy the restaurants and parks in West Launceston. You might want to make time for a stop at Cataract Gorge or Cataract Gorge Reserve.

South Launceston
Restaurants and spas are some things travelers note about South Launceston. Check out Centro Meadow Mews Shopping Centre or Brisbane Street Mall while you're familiarizing yourself with the larger area.
